When Lady Tremaine snatches the Fairy Godmother’s wand, she rewrites the past, erasing Cinderella’s happy ending and fitting the glass slipper to another foot. Cinderella, aided by her animal friends and the godmother, races through time to fix the timeline and win back her true love.
